Block

#18,345,758
Block Number
18,345,758 @ 2024-04-25 03:02:50
Status
Finalized
ID
0x0117ef1e3c3d22357afdd224af7235e0a7ea7db484c46ae755cb0d388fb16657
Transactions
Gas Used
21000/30227809 (0.07% Used)
Total Score
1,788,251,261 (+97)
Rewards
0.06 VTHO